Take a hard look at yourself
by: Lauren - Admin

If you continually struggle to get a massage job you need to take a hard look at the way you are presenting yourself rather than blame it on others.

For example, your posting included several grammar and spelling problems (some I fixed and others I left). Have you made similar mistakes on your resume and cover letters?

Details count. You should expect employers to be picky. They don't want to entrust their business to just anybody. They want somebody that inspires confidence.

Are you inspiring confidence?

attitude
by: Anne

The best way to get a massage job is to have the right attitude. You cannot dislike picky people because almost everyone you will come in contact with as a massage therapist is picky. You need to be clean, very well groomed, no body jewelry, no perfumes, speak calmly, intelligently,clearly, and always smile. Be self confident but not ego driven.
